首页 jaee学生信息管理系统报告

jaee学生信息管理系统报告

举报
开通vip

jaee学生信息管理系统报告1.课程设计目的做一个学生信息管理系统,要求运用到JavaEE中的二层模式做java代码和jsp设计都要用上。要求要有后台,就是说要连接到数据库。适当的运用javascript和css2.课程设计题目描述和需求分析课程设计题目:学生信息管理系统需求分析:功能分析:(1)用户登录:用户登录(一个界面)通过验证分为管理员,学生,老师登陆三个主页面(2)学生信息管理:管理员对学生信息进行删除,查询和修改。(3)课程信息管理:管理员也可以进行删除,修改和查询功能,同时学生可以选课和查询该课程成绩,和查询课程成绩。老师根据所...

jaee学生信息管理系统报告
1.课程设计目的做一个学生信息管理系统,要求运用到JavaEE中的二层模式做java代码和jsp设计都要用上。要求要有后台,就是说要连接到数据库。适当的运用javascript和css2.课程设计题目描述和需求 分析 定性数据统计分析pdf销售业绩分析模板建筑结构震害分析销售进度分析表京东商城竞争战略分析 课程设计题目:学生信息管理系统需求分析:功能分析:(1)用户登录:用户登录(一个界面)通过验证分为管理员,学生,老师登陆三个主页面(2)学生信息管理:管理员对学生信息进行删除,查询和修改。(3)课程信息管理:管理员也可以进行删除,修改和查询功能,同时学生可以选课和查询该课程成绩,和查询课程成绩。老师根据所授课程对学生录入成绩(4)用户管理:三种用户可进行注销进行切换,可以修改密码3.课程设计报告内容学生信息管理系统项目设计3.1.1系统功能结构设计(javaSwing界面)登陆教师登学生登管理员录修查选查修录修删修入改询课询改入改除改成成成成密基学学密3.1.2逻辑结构设计(数据库表和存储过程等)一.数据表说明基本表:1.表Table1(管理员信息表)字段名数据类型长度主键否描述usernovarchar50是用户名passwordvarchar50否密码2.表student(学生基本信息表)字段名数据类型长度主键否描述snovarchar50是学号passvarchar50否密码snamevarchar50否姓名gradevarchar50否年级sagevarchar50否年龄sexvarchar50否性别classnovarchar50否班级号3.表teacher(老师基本信息表)字段名数据类型长度主键否描述tnovarchar50是教师号tpssvarchar50否密码tnamevarchar50否教师姓名sexvarchar50否性别jibievarchar50否职称telvarchar50否电话号码4.表class(学生班级信息表)字段名数据类型长度主键否描述classnovarchar50是班级号classnamevarchar50否班级名称departnovarchar50否系名5.表depart(系表)字段名数据类型长度主键否描述departnovarchar50是系名departnamevarchar50否系名6.表course(课程表)字段名数据类型长度主键否描述cnovarchar50是课程号cnamevarchar50否课程名classdayint4否上课日期classtimeint4否上课时间ctypevarchar50否课程类型tnamevarchar50否授课老师名派生出来的表8.表courseClass(班级必修课表)字段名数据类型长度主键否描述classnovarchar50是班级号cnovarchar50是课程号tnovarchar50否教师号9.表sc(选课表)字段名数据类型长度主键否描述snovarchar50是学号cnamevarchar50否课程名tnamevarchar50否教师名9.表score(成绩表)字段名数据类型长度主键否描述snovarchar50是学号cnovarchar50是课程号scorevarchar50否分 数学 数学高考答题卡模板高考数学答题卡模板三年级数学混合运算测试卷数学作业设计案例新人教版八年级上数学教学计划 生信息管理的所有运行界面登陆界面:管理员登陆:管理员登陆后可以对学生基本信息进行添加删除和修改也可对学籍和班级进行同样的操作老师登陆:老师登陆后录入成绩:1.根据教师号和班级号查出老师所教班的所教课程号2.然后根据班级号列显出此班同学的信息再对此班同学录入成绩3.因为一些不能实现的原因,所以本人只能多学生一个个在第三个页面中依次录入最后录入的成绩将保存到数据库中去学生登陆:学生选课:1.根据sql语句将学生课程表中课程类型为选修课的信息全部调出来学生查看选课表来进行选课2.通过下面的下拉菜单(为选课信息)将自己想选的课选出来操作选课成功:选课后课进行学生个人课表查询:老师在录入成绩后可进行成绩查询:分为录入前和录入后录入后这里学生的成绩信息为四行说明前面就有四门老师对此学生录入的成绩。此学生的成绩是从数据库中调用出来的。项目运行情况运行环境:Server2000TomcatProperties核心代码及技术教师录入成绩:TeacherCl中可以查询到教师所教课程的课程号和班级的方法在页面上显示登录老师的班级号和课程号再通过链接到他所教的班级所有的学生列表链接到了此页面后,下一步就是录入成绩录入成绩验证成绩录入成功了4. 总结 初级经济法重点总结下载党员个人总结TXt高中句型全总结.doc高中句型全总结.doc理论力学知识点总结pdf 这次课程设计真的是花了很多时间和精力去做的。先要构思,光想就不敢下手,这种状态就保持了一个星期,盲目的在网上查关于学生信息管理的 资料 新概念英语资料下载李居明饿命改运学pdf成本会计期末资料社会工作导论资料工程结算所需资料清单 。等到确定要动手去做的时候,真的无从下手,感觉自己要完成一个项目就觉得纠结。看到宿舍的人做的那么晚,自己就开始熬夜做这份课程设计,有的时候一个晚上就只能解决一个问题,但是解决出来真的很开心,虽然代码很冗长不简洁。等到两个星期过去以后,越做到后面就觉得前面有许多地方矛盾,弄的很不好,所以就开始感觉数据库不是很清晰,所以就回头开始整理数据库。因为数据库比较灵活,所以感觉在管理员那个界面对学生信息进行操作的一些代码开始出现了大批的错误,就只能一点一点的开始修改,找错。在这个过程中,真的让人觉得很吃力,所以以后做什么的时候一定要先将数据库弄好再开始敲代码。因为不好改,所以在管理员界面,有的还没有弄好,最后演示的时候还是出了一些无法显示的问题。所以自己就直接做学生和老师界面的一些功能,这些都需要联系到数据库,因为这些事是数据库整理清楚和才开始做的,所以这两块做的比较清晰,没有那么糊涂。等到那天演示成果以后,就感觉自己完成了任务,感觉自己还蛮开心的,可能还有很多不好的地方,但是完成了,就真的觉得是最大的亮点了。
本文档为【jaee学生信息管理系统报告】,请使用软件OFFICE或WPS软件打开。作品中的文字与图均可以修改和编辑, 图片更改请在作品中右键图片并更换,文字修改请直接点击文字进行修改,也可以新增和删除文档中的内容。
该文档来自用户分享,如有侵权行为请发邮件ishare@vip.sina.com联系网站客服,我们会及时删除。
[版权声明] 本站所有资料为用户分享产生,若发现您的权利被侵害,请联系客服邮件isharekefu@iask.cn,我们尽快处理。
本作品所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用。
网站提供的党政主题相关内容(国旗、国徽、党徽..)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
下载需要: 免费 已有0 人下载
最新资料
资料动态
专题动态
is_113440
暂无简介~
格式:pdf
大小:179KB
软件:PDF阅读器
页数:7
分类:
上传时间:2019-07-18
浏览量:2